Prairie Fare: Have You Applauded a Cow Lately?

Cows produce about 90 glasses of milk per day, or enough to quench the thirst of 30 children with three glasses of milk daily. During a cow’s lifetime, that’s 200,000 glasses of milk.

Prairie Fare: Try a Fruit With Appeal

Bananas have been a popular fruit for thousands of years. In early times, bananas were held in such high esteem they became known as the ""fruit of the wise man"" and ""fruit of paradise.""
